Why Hidden Leaks Are So Dangerous

A small drip behind the wall or under the floor might not seem urgent, but over time, it can lead to mold, structural damage, and inflated utility bills. These leaks often occur in hard-to-access places, such as:

  • Behind drywall
  • Beneath bathroom floors
  • Inside slab foundations
  • Under sinks and cabinetry

Advanced Leak Detection Methods Used By Plumbers

Today’s top plumbing professionals use non-invasive technology and experience-driven techniques to pinpoint leaks without tearing apart your home. Here are the top tools and strategies used by trusted Maryland plumber teams and Germantown plumbers:

1. Thermal Imaging Cameras

Thermal cameras detect temperature differences behind walls and floors. Since leaking water is typically colder than its surroundings, these cameras highlight the affected areas using color-coded imaging. This helps plumbers find the exact location of a leak, even before moisture becomes visible.

2. Moisture Meters

Moisture meters measure the water content in building materials like wood, drywall, or tile. If there’s a leak, the meter will show elevated readings in localized areas, even if the wall looks dry to the naked eye.

This tool is especially useful in identifying slow leaks near water heaters, kitchen faucets, and under sinks—places where damage builds up quietly over time.

3. Acoustic Listening Devices

These tools help detect the sound of water escaping from pipes within walls or beneath the ground. Acoustic devices are particularly effective for underground or slab leak detection and are often used by a water line repair expert when homeowners report strange noises or reduced water pressure.

4. Video Pipe Inspection

Small waterproof cameras can be inserted into plumbing lines to visually inspect for cracks, corrosion, or blockages. This method is frequently used by plumbers in Maryland and is also helpful for pinpointing leaks in complex pipe networks.

What Signs to Watch for at Home

 

Before calling a plumber, you may notice warning signs that something’s wrong. These include:

  • Unexplained increase in water bills
  • Moldy or musty smells
  • Discoloration on walls or ceilings
  • Peeling paint or bubbling wallpaper
  • Puddles or damp spots with no obvious source

How Local Plumbers Prevent Further Damage

Once a leak is located, licensed professionals act fast to prevent further water intrusion. Depending on the severity and location, solutions may include:

  • Resealing pipe joints
  • Replacing sections of damaged piping
  • Full water line repair service
  • Replacing faulty fixtures
  • Insulating pipes to prevent future leaks during winter
